No, this in not a blog about gardening in any way, but a journal of my journey to become a professional landscape painting artist. For years, I’ve given my paintings as wedding gifts without thinking of profiting in some way from it. I worked for 18 years at the Metropolitan Museum of Art in NYC as a computer programmer. I have been a painter since 1990, coincidentally, when I started working at the Met. I watched Bob Ross do his thing on Channel 13 in New York and decided I could do this, too. I have no formal training. I incorporate Bob's wet-on-wet technique for sky and water. My subject matter is covered bridges, lighthouses, fishing village scenes, barns, etc. Maine, Nantucket, Martha’s Vineyard, Nova Scotia and Spain are some of the places I have painted. My style is detailed and sometimes people think a photo of the painting is an actual photo of the scene. I hope to continue and grow in this medium. I also like to cook & dance. Exhibit #3 of the First Baptist Summer Art Gallery

I put up the third exhibition of my church's 2014 Summer Art Gallery. This is posted on the church's FB and Twitter pages 
 
First Baptist Hackensack Summer Art Gallery
Press Release from the Office of the Curator
Release date : 8/3/2014
Subject: Third Exhibition of the Summer Art Gallery
For: Immediate Release

The Curator is pleased to announce the third exhibition of this year's Summer Art Gallery. This time we have 3 artists displaying their work.

The Needle work of Carolyn Obrien
Carolyn has been doing needle work for over 30 years. She has been a member here for many years and her daughter Dawn O'Brien Beckley was raised here and married in this church. She have always enjoyed creating with her hands, sewing clothing is her first love. Now she enjoys using needle and thread to create these works of art. She has included several of Dawn's creations also which hang in her home,

The Art of Jack McKenzie

Jack is long time member of FBH, active in many areas and is the Curator of this gallery. He's been painting since 1990 when he watched Bob Ross do his thing on Channel 13 in New York and decided he could do this, too. His subject matter is covered bridges, lighthouses, fishing village scenes, barns, etc. from places like Maine, Nantucket, Martha’s Vineyard, Nova Scotia and Spain. Jack usually paints from photographs and likes to paint in bright colors that can inspire an on-the-spot visual vacation.

A Painting by Olivia Grace Feliciano
We have one work by Olivia. She is entering 2nd grade at Hackensack Christian School. She loves to be creative and especially loves to draw and paint. This oil painting is titled Snow Falls. It was painted over her spring break in April 2014
